# Active CRLH Transmission Line Modeler
|
||||
|
||||
A MATLAB simulation of an **active Composite Right/Left-Handed (CRLH) transmission line** with a frequency-dependent negative resistance element. The structure achieves controlled gain across a user-defined passband by embedding an active shunt element (modeled as a negative resistance `Rn`) within a periodic CRLH unit cell topology.
|
||||
This is supplemental code for the paper "Negative Resistance Enabled Amplifying CRLH Transmission Lines With Uniform Insertion Gain" (https://ieeexplore.ieee.org/document/11366944)
